does anyone know a good way of waterproofing all the connections under the bonnet? im having major problems with spray getting in somewhere and killing the engine. its getting to the point where im not keen on driving when the roads are wet in case i brake down again!

plastic bags and elastic bands? heat shrink?

Go rounds and clean all the connections and spray with silicon spray or spray grease, it'll replel most of anything but it will be messy.
